Output 6725d555e9ff8bac9d4bd4956dfb8d45c1e11b8a479f584ecb481c4da9ea21ea:91

value
1016904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e6b0974a1e2861afe8dd39b70109264d11d3f70 OP_EQUAL
address
3DDTHmg9aXScSzA7khkRaf991AoX4D3iZn
transaction
6725d555e9ff8bac9d4bd4956dfb8d45c1e11b8a479f584ecb481c4da9ea21ea
confirmations
303576
spent
true